Formula

kL/wk = hL/min × 1008

hL/min = kL/wk ÷ 1008

Frequently asked questions

What is the source unit in this conversion?

The source unit is hectoliters per minute (hL/min). The Hectoliter (hL) is a unit of volume. The Minute (min) is a unit of time.

What is the destination unit in this conversion?

The destination unit is kiloliters per week (kL/wk). The Kiloliter (kL) is a unit of volume. The Week (wk) is a unit of time.

How do I convert hectoliters per minute to kiloliters per week?

Multiply the hectoliters per minute value by 1008 to get kiloliters per week. For example, 10 hL/min × 1008 = 10080 kL/wk.

Is the hectoliters per minute to kiloliters per week conversion exact?

It's exact under the SI-based volume and time definitions used here, since both units convert to cubic meters per second through fixed, non-rounded factors.

Where is this conversion commonly used?

Flow rate conversions like this are used in plumbing, HVAC, irrigation, chemical processing, fuel and water metering, and engineering flow calculations.

Can I convert kiloliters per week back to hectoliters per minute?

Yes. Divide the kiloliters per week value by 1008 (or multiply by 0.000992063) to get hectoliters per minute.

About this conversion

This page converts hectoliters per minute (hL/min) into kiloliters per week (kL/wk), two units of volumetric flow rate.

The Hectoliter (hL) is a unit of volume. The Minute (min) is a unit of time.

The Kiloliter (kL) is a unit of volume. The Week (wk) is a unit of time.

The formula is kL/wk = hL/min × 1008, based on the fixed relationship between these two flow rate units.

Flow rate is calculated as a volume unit divided by a time unit, so every combination of a volume unit and a time unit forms a valid, exact flow rate unit.
